In general, you'll simply need more PBN sites. Going from nowhere to page 2 or 3 is easy. Going from page 2 to page 1 is already a little harder, but the real challenge is ranking on the very top of page 1. Why? Have a look here: https://moz.com/blog/google-organic-click-through-rates-in-2014 So, being #1 means you are getting 10 times the traffic the low positions on page 1 get. Being #8 means you are getting the breadcrumbs the top players leave on the table.
